Capital Medical Center Welcomes New CEO
November 30, 2007Capital Medical Center has announced Michael Motte as its new Chief Executive Officer. Motte has a longstanding history with the hospital and the South Sound community as he served as the Chief Financial Officer from 2001- 2005. He will be rejoining the hospital in early January 2008. Motte is currently the Chief Financial Officer at Mary Black Health System in Spartanburg, South Carolina. “I feel like I’m returning home. I’m headed back to a great medical staff, hospital, and community,” said Motte. Chief Operating Officer, Tom Pemberton from the hospital’s parent company, Capella said, “Capella is extremely pleased to have Mike taking over the reins of Capital Medical Center. This is a fine hospital, and we are confident that Mike will build on the hospital’s reputation for high quality healthcare for all patients. He is a great fit for Capital Medical Center.” “The Board is excited to have Mike as the new CEO and believes his history with the community and healthcare experience will ensure Capital Medical Center is a leader in technology, state-of-the-art equipment, and high quality patient care,” said Kevin Ekar, Capital Medical Center’s Chairman of the Board. Motte succeeds Ron Butler, Interim CEO who has held the position since September when Rick Carter left to pursue other healthcare opportunities.
